Bob Kahler, Chief Financial Officer at CBE Companies (CBE), received the Waterloo-Cedar Falls Courier’s Top Finance Leadership Award this spring. CBE employees joined key members of the Waterloo-Cedar Falls Courier to congratulate Kahler at a recent award ceremony.

The award recognizes top financial officers for innovation and business and organizational leadership. The Courier annually recognizes the best of the best in finance leaders in CBE’s home community.

Tom Penaluna,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er at CBE, nominated Kahler for the award because of his leadership, work ethic and commitment to excellence.

“Mr. Kahler is one of those individuals who helps maintain stability in our community by not asking for any acknowledgement of his efforts but always maintains a work ethic that is unparalleled in the workforce and through his civic duties,” Penaluna said, “He is here at CBE day in and day out before others arrive to the office and many days is the last to leave and many times is found working on the weekends. Bob is one of those unsung heroes who maintains stability by his unrelenting work effort and high integrity.”

Kahler joined CBE in 1998 after more than 16 years in the banking industry. He oversees the company’s finance department and serves as treasurer for the corporation.

The Courier identifies top finance leaders based on leadership in their company’s financial success, employee retention skills and innovative methods to maintain overall health of their organizations.

CBE Companies is a global business process outsourcing (BPO) organization and is the parent company of CBE Group, CBE Customer Solutions, and Argent Account Acquisitions. CBE Companies is supported by a leadership team of tenured industry experts. Its workforce of dedicated professionals is quickly growing. CBE Companies currently employs over 1,200 people in five locations globally. Its corporate headquarters is located in Cedar Falls, Iowa, with additional facilities in Waterloo, Iowa; Overland Park, Kansas; Haverhill, Massachusetts and Manila, Philippines. The organization is consistently recognized as a top five Employer of Choice in the Cedar Valley.  It has also been recognized by Workplace Dynamics as one of Iowa’s Top Workplaces.
